The Hollowvale Hunger

Something in Hollowvale must be fed.

The town has always demanded a sacrifice, a ritual that has kept the Hunger at bay for centuries. But when the last Offering is refused, the rules change-and Hollowvale begins to consume everything.

The once-forgotten town is now spreading, stretching beyond its cursed borders. Entire families vanish overnight, leaving only their clothes behind. Shadows move where there should be none. The forest whispers with voices of the long-dead. And deep beneath the earth, something ancient is waking-something with too many bones, too many teeth, and an appetite that will never be satisfied.

Lucas and Cora, the last survivors of Hollowvale, thought they had escaped. But the Hunger has followed them, bleeding into the world beyond. As the town prepares for its final sacrifice, they must uncover the darkest secret of all-Hollowvale was never meant to be a place. It was meant to be a mouth.

Now, the question is no longer who will be taken.

It's whether anything will be left at all.

A chilling, slow-burn horror novel filled with creeping dread, The Hollowvale Hunger is the next terrifying installment in the Hollowvale saga-where nothing stays buried, and the past is always hungry.
